The AEB does not cover: 16-19 year-olds, apprenticeships, education and training services funded by the European Social Fund, individuals resident in a devolved authority area unless they meet certain criteria (see sections below for more), or 19+ advanced learner loans. WebJul 26, 2024 · P397 Family members of EEA nationals who have obtained pre-settled or settled status under the EU Settlement Scheme are eligible for funding if: P397.1 They (the family member) have been ordinarily resident in the UK or EEA for at least the previous three years before the start of the apprenticeship.
